DT200WR with DT200R YPVS/CDI — YPVS fully closes at max opening/high RPM, AC signal voltage drops from 300V to 180V

1 Upvotes

I have a DT200WR fitted with a CDI and YPVS module from a DT200R.

The problem: at low-to-mid RPM the YPVS works fine, opening normally as I rev up. But after a certain RPM, right as it reaches maximum opening, it suddenly closes completely.

What I've already tested and ruled out:

  • The module and servo themselves — I bench-tested by feeding the module a simulated RPM signal via Arduino, and it opened perfectly up to 9000 RPM with zero issues;
  • Swapped the CDI for another unit — the exact same fault persists;
  • Servo gear ratio — swapped it out, behavior unchanged.

One important observation: measuring the RPM signal wire going to the module, I noticed the AC voltage drops by about half at high RPM — right around the point where the YPVS starts closing and oscillating. It starts at 300VAC and ends up at 180VAC.

Since the fault only happens with the real signal from the bike (not the simulated one), I'm out of ideas as to what could be causing it. Has anyone seen something like this before?
